Summary Minutes:Regular City Commission Meeting May 19,2016 City of Sunny Isles Beach.Florida <br /> 10. RESOLUTIONS <br /> 10A. A Resolution of the City Commission of the City of Sunny Isles Beach,Florida,Authorizing <br /> the Chief of Police,in Accordance with the Comprehensive Crime Control Act of 1984,and <br /> in Accordance with Section 932.7055,F.S.,to Expend Partial Forfeiture Funds from the <br /> Department of Justice (DOJ) for the Purchase of Six (6) Police Vehicles, Two (2) Police <br /> Motorcycles,and All Associated Equipment,Markings and Lighting,and a Prorated Portion <br /> of Costs to Replace the Police/City Hall Telecommunications System,in a Total Amount Not <br /> to Exceed $347,305.48; Providing for an Effective Date. <br /> Action:[City Clerk's Note: Items 10A and 10B were heard together.] City Clerk Hines read <br /> the title, and Captain Michael Grandinetti reported. <br /> Public Speakers: None <br /> Commissioner Aelion moved and Vice Mayor Gatto seconded a motion to approve the <br /> resolution. Resolution No. 2016-2548 was adopted by a voice vote of 5-0 in favor. <br /> 10B. A Resolution of the City Commission of the City of Sunny Isles Beach,Florida,Authorizing <br /> the Purchase of Sixteen (16) Police Vehicles, Two (2) Police Motorcycles, and All <br /> Associated Equipment, Markings and Lighting, in a Total Amount Not to Exceed <br /> $585,979.66, Attached Hereto as Exhibit "A"; Authorizing the City Manager to Do All <br /> Things Necessary to Effectuate this Resolution; Providing For An Effective Date. <br /> Action: [City Clerk's Note: Items 10A and JOB were heard together.] City Clerk Hines <br /> read the title, and Captain Michael Grandinetti reported noting the total cost coming out of <br /> Forfeiture is$266,906.67 for vehicles,the remainder are budgeted vehicles out of this year's <br /> budget. The vehicles are being purchased through the Florida Sheriffs Association Contract. <br /> Public Speakers: None <br /> Commissioner Aelion moved and Vice Mayor Gatto seconded a motion to approve the <br /> resolution. Resolution No. 2016-2549 was adopted by a voice vote of 5-0 in favor. <br /> 10C. A Resolution of the City Commission of the City of Sunny Isles Beach,Florida,Approving <br /> the Donation of up to Fifteen (15) Surplus Philips Automatic External Defibrillators <br /> (AED's) to a Non-Profit Organization, the "Jamaicans Abroad Helping Jamaicans at <br /> Home" (JAHJAH)Foundation;Authorizing the City Manager to Do All Things Necessary <br /> to Effectuate this Resolution; Providing for an Effective Date. <br /> Action: City Clerk Hines read the title, and Captain Michael Grandinetti reported that <br /> JAHJAH is a Foundation that donates medical supplies and equipment, and even expertise <br /> and knowledge to hospitals and medical centers in Jamaica. We have several defibrillators <br /> that we have taken out of service due to age, technology has changed and we have replaced <br /> them over the years. <br /> Public Speakers: None <br /> Commissioner Aelion moved and Commissioner Levin seconded a motion to approve the <br /> resolution. Resolution No. 2016-2550 was adopted by a voice vote of 5-0 in favor. <br /> 7 <br />
